Falls
account for about half of all accidental deaths in the home.
They are the leading cause of accidental death for the elderly. |

| Falls are serious business. Most injuries caused by falls happen at ground level and not from high places. Chances of falling increase when it is dark, when things are not put away, and when spills are not cleaned up quickly. Broken or damaged household items may also result in falls. | |||
